Clinical Decision Guide

When Is Treatment Required?

Not all brain tumors or cranial conditions require immediate surgery. Some slow-growing tumors can be safely monitored through periodic scans.

Treatment may be recommended when

Symptoms interfere with daily life
Tumor growth is observed
Brain pressure increases
Neurological deficits appear
Diagnosis confirmation is necessary

⚠ Is Surgery the Only Option?

Not every brain tumor needs surgery immediately. Careful observation is often part of the treatment pathway. Specialist evaluation helps determine whether treatment is necessary and which approach offers the safest and most effective outcome.

✓ Not Based on Diagnosis Alone

The decision for treatment is based on how much symptoms affect daily life, tumor behavior, and overall health - not on the presence of a condition alone. Doctors consider growth patterns, neurological function, and response to monitoring.

Pricing Transparency

Cost of Brain Tumor & Cranial Procedures in Bangalore

Treatment costs vary depending on the type of procedure, tumor complexity, hospital facilities, and duration of care. Estimated ranges are shared below for reference.

Craniotomy (Tumor Removal)
₹ 50,000 - ₹ 4,00,000
Open brain surgery . ICU stay typically 2-4 days.
Complex Cases
Stereotactic Radiosurgery
₹ 20,000 - ₹ 3,00,000
Non-invasive . Day procedure, no hospital stay required.
Non-Surgical
Endoscopic Brain Surgery
₹ 1,00,000 - ₹ 2,50,000
Minimally invasive . 2-3 day hospital stay.
Minimally Invasive
VP Shunt / CSF Diversion
₹ 90,000 - ₹ 2,00,000
Hydrocephalus management . 2-4 day stay post surgery.
Popular Choice
Skull Base Surgery
₹ 2,00,000 - ₹ 5,00,000
Complex approach . Neuro-ICU stay of 3-5 days.
Advanced
Neuro-ICU & Post-Op Care
₹ 5,000 - ₹ 40,000 /day
Critical monitoring, ventilator support if needed.
Per Day

Cost estimates are typically discussed after clinical evaluation

to ensure accurate planning. Insurance and cashless options may be available depending on the procedure and hospital network.
